Project Curriculum and County Toolkits

We have lots of educational resources for 4-H’ers working on individual projects, as well as clubs working on group projects and educational activities. Most items listed are curriculum books that are ready for volunteers to pick up,  include a list of the materials you need, how much time it will take, how to do the activity, and then the questions to ask as part of the Experiential Learning Process. 4-H curriculum is built for sequential activities, so project and life skills can be built upon, practiced, and eventually mastered over time.
